What is a legal process server?

Legal process servers are individuals authorized to deliver legal documents, such as subpoenas, summonses, complaints, and other court papers, to parties involved in legal proceedings. Their primary role is to ensure that due process is followed by notifying individuals or businesses of their involvement in a court case. Process servers must adhere to specific legal guidelines and procedures to ensure the service is valid and recognized by the courts. They may also be required to provide proof of service, which is a document confirming the delivery of legal papers. Proper service of process is a critical step in upholding the rights and obligations of all parties in a legal matter.

What are some common challenges faced by legal process servers, and how can they be effectively managed?

Legal Process Servers often encounter challenges such as locating individuals who are difficult to find, handling confrontational situations, and managing a high volume of assignments with tight deadlines. Building strong research skills, staying organized, and maintaining professionalism under pressure are key to overcoming these obstacles. Many process servers also collaborate with law firms and utilize specialized databases and tools to track down recipients efficiently. Developing effective communication and de-escalation techniques can help manage interactions during service, ensuring both safety and compliance with legal requirements.

How to become a legal process server?

To become a legal process server, you must typically be at least 18 years old, pass a background check, and complete any required training or certification mandated by your state. South Carolina does not require a specific license, but servers must follow state laws regarding service of process and may need to register with local courts or authorities.
